Hi ilko_t, jaclaz, Thanks for the reply. Today I tried to reinstall WindowsXP using WinSetupFromUSB 0.2.3, but it came back with the same problem when I used USB_MultiBoot.cmd. Yes, it is exantly same as what I mentioned in the first post, the system came out with error message "Setup cannot access the CD containing the WindowsXP installation files" after Step 1. Here I explained what steps I have done: 1) As I mentioned, the computer I intend to reinstalled had been formatted but I kept another copy of i386 folder elsewhere. 2) I copy that i386 folder (WindowsXP) and paste it in another computer running Windows7. 3) I ran WinSetupFromUSB 0.2.3 4) I plugged in USB-stick and format it using RMPrepUSB button in the program. 5) Then I prepared the USB-stick by clicking "Go". 6) Everything done, I plugged that USB-stick to the computer I wish to installed WindowsXP and swtich on the computer. 7) The computer is Dell Inspiron 600m, I pressed F12 and select to boot from USB-flash drive. 8) I came to the menu with selection "WindowsXP Setup + First and Second parts". 9) I proceed with the steps. 10) The system ask me to agree on the term & condition for Windows, of course "I agree". 11) I came to the page showing drive and partition of my computer. I chose drive C: and continue. 12) I select to "Format as NTFS FileSystem (Quick)". 13) After the formatting, the exactly same error message came out, it reads "Setup cannot access the CD containing the Windows XP installation files. To retry, press ENTER. If you are not successful after several tries, quite Setup. Then,to restart Setup, copy the Windows XP installation files to your hard disk. To quit Setup, press F3". -----Everything is the same as I used USB_MultiBootBoot.cmd. The WindowsXP just didn't installed itself from the USB. It doesn't help even I used WinSetupFromUSB 0.2.3. Do this have to do with my source of XP? ANYHOW, thinking that the program might work different way, I press F3, reboot the computer and continue with Step 2 - GUI mode part of the setup. As I selected Step 2, the menu of Boot.ini came out. I chose the first selection, "Continue setup from Disk 0 Part 1". It came with hal.dll error. OKAY. There are more instruction, that I should tried other selection if this error came out. I tried the next entries, "Setup from Disk 0 Part 2". It is the same, came back with hal.dll error. I kept on trying on next entries, Disk 0 Part 3, Disk 0 Part 4... etc However, all attempt start from Disk 0 Part 3 onwards came out with error message as below: "Windows could not start because of a computer disk hardward configuation problem. Could not read from the selected boot disk. Check boot path and disk hardware. Please check the windows documentation about hardware disk configuration and your hardware reference manuals for additional information". So, I did not success to reinstalled the Windows. Is there any steps I have done wrong that causes all this problem? What can I do to make everything works OK? Thanks...
